London (LHR) to Toulouse/Blagnac (TLS) Flight Distance

The flight distance from London Heathrow Airport (LHR) in London, United Kingdom to Toulouse-Blagnac Airport (TLS) in Toulouse/Blagnac, France is 882 kilometers (548 miles / 476 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ying south at a heading of 170°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ting United Kingdom with France.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 07:47 in London, it's 08:47 in Toulouse/Blagnac.

The return flight from Toulouse/Blagnac (TLS) to London (LHR) follows a heading of 352° (north).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
